**Key Ceremony Checklist — Item 7: WaveGlimpse preview signer**

Okay, security folks, this one's for the audio waveform preview service. WaveGlimpse signs its rendered preview images so clients can verify they match the source track. During the ceremony, confirm the signing key was generated on the air-gapped laptop, witnessed by two custodians, and that the old key is marked revoked in the ledger. Once both custodians initial the sheet, seal the backup card and record the recovery passphrase directly below.

recovery phrase for fawif-tajeg: norael-aldmir-casir-brivan-ulaion

**Key ceremony checklist — item 7: vendored fonts**

Confirm all third-party fonts for Brightquill are vendored into `assets/fonts/` with license files beside them. No CDN fetches at build time — the ceremony machine is airgapped. Run the font manifest check; any missing hash fails the signing step. If the manifest vault prompts, enter the recovery passphrase below.

unlock words, hahip-baduf: holwyn-istath-julvan

## v2.8.0 — Canary gating update

Heads up, plugin folks: Glimmerhost now blocks canary promotion if your plugin's error rate climbs above 0.5% during the bake window. No more sneaking past with a quick retry loop — the gate checks rolling averages. Update your manifests to declare health endpoints before the next release train. Questions about gating rules go to our canary lead.

account owner for yahog-kafop: Istius Rusix